Phase 1 - Return to School - Week 3 - Monday 11th May
We have been working hard preparing for this term and the various phases that the Premier and Minister for Education have announced for NSW schools during COVID-19. The new phase model is flexible, allowing students to be reintroduced to some face-to-face learning at school, starting from week 3. The school has an enrolment of 278 students in 11 classrooms with limited extra teaching/learning spaces.
Please see the timetable attached that will commence in Week 3. Our school goal is to educate your children safely and maintain their social and emotional wellbeing. We will be using our larger teaching/learning spaces to ensure social distancing measures are adhered to.
Each day we have allocated two to three classes on site plus children of essential service workers. Initially the minister has stated approximately 25% (70 students) are expected to be on site at any one time.
Parents and carers are encouraged to send their child to school on their allocated day during this transition phase.
Grade teachers are aligned to their usual class which will allow explicit face to face teaching and explicit feedback for each student per class. The main teaching content on this day will be focused on literacy and numeracy.
The school will still be open and operational for students that need to attend on days other than their timetabled day, but where practical, parents are encouraged to keep their children at home.
